Four compounds were isolated from Brazilian propolis. They are identified a
s: (1) 3-prenyl-4-hydroxycinnamic acid (PHCA), (2) 2,2-dimethyl-6-carboxyet
henyl-2H-1-benzopyrane (DCBEN), (3) 3,5-diprenyl-4-hydroxycinnamic acid (DH
CA), and (4) 2,2-dimethyl-6-carboxyethenyl-8-prenyl-2H-1-benzopyran (DPB).
The structures of the compounds were determined by MS and NMR techniques. A
ll compounds were assayed against Trypanosoma cruzi and the bacteria Escher
ichia coli, Pseudomonas aeruginosa, Staphylococcus aureus and Streptococcus
faecalis. Compounds (1) to (4) were active against T. cruzi. Except (1), a
ll compounds presented activity against the bacteria tested. When compounds
(1)-(3) were tested in the guinea pig isolated trachea, all induced a rela
xant effect similar to propolis extract. (C) 2001 Elsevier Science Ireland
